Company's Indemnification of Purchasers. The Company shall indemnify each Selling Stockholder, each of its officers, directors and constituent partners, and each person controlling (within the meaning of the Securities Act) such Selling Stockholder, against all claims, losses, damages or liabilities (or actions in respect thereof) suffered or incurred by any of them, to the extent such claims, losses, damages or liabilities arise out of or are based upon any untrue statement (or alleged untrue statement) of a material fact contained in any prospectus or any related Registration Statement incident to any such Registration, or any omission (or alleged omission) to state therein a material fact required to be stated therein or necessary to make the statements therein not misleading, or any violation by the Company of any rule or regulation promulgated under the Securities Act applicable to the Company and relating to actions or inaction required of the Company in connection with any such Registration; and the Company will reimburse each such Selling Stockholder, each of its officers, directors and constituent partners and each person who controls any such Selling Stockholder, for any reasonable, documented legal and other expenses incurred in connection with investigating or defending any such claim, loss, damage, liability or action; PROVIDED, HOWEVER, that the indemnity contained in this Section 2.7.1 shall not apply to amounts paid in settlement of any such claim, loss, damage, liability or action if settlement is effected without the consent of the Company (which consent shall not unreasonably be withheld); and PROVIDED, FURTHER, that the Company will not be liable in any such case to the extent that any such claim, loss, damage, liability or expense arises out of or is based upon any untrue (or alleged untrue) statement or omission based upon written information furnished to the Company by such Selling Stockholder, underwriter, controlling person or other indemnified person and stated to be for use in connection with the offering of securities of the Company.

Company's Indemnification of Purchasers. To the extent permitted by law, the Company shall defend, indemnify and hold harmless each of the Purchasers from and against any and all losses, claims, judgments, liabilities, demands, charges, suits, penalties, costs or expenses, including court costs and attorneys’ fees resulting from any claim, demand, suit, action or proceeding brought by any third party (“Claims and Liabilities”) with respect to or arising from (i) the breach of any warranty or any inaccuracy of any representation made by the Company in this Agreement or in the Security Agreement, or (ii) the breach of any covenant or agreement made by the Company in this Agreement or the Security Agreement.

  • Indemnification of Purchasers Subject to the provisions of this Section 4.8, the Company will indemnify and hold each Purchaser and its directors, officers, shareholders, members, partners, employees and agents (and any other Persons with a functionally equivalent role of a Person holding such titles notwithstanding a lack of such title or any other title), each Person who controls such Purchaser (within the meaning of Section 15 of the Securities Act and Section 20 of the Exchange Act), and the directors, officers, shareholders, agents, members, partners or employees (and any other Persons with a functionally equivalent role of a Person holding such titles notwithstanding a lack of such title or any other title) of such controlling persons (each, a “Purchaser Party”) harmless from any and all losses, liabilities, obligations, claims, contingencies, damages, costs and expenses, including all judgments, amounts paid in settlements, court costs and reasonable attorneys’ fees and costs of investigation that any such Purchaser Party may suffer or incur as a result of or relating to (a) any breach of any of the representations, warranties, covenants or agreements made by the Company in this Agreement or in the other Transaction Documents or (b) any action instituted against the Purchaser Parties in any capacity, or any of them or their respective Affiliates, by any stockholder of the Company who is not an Affiliate of such Purchaser Party, with respect to any of the transactions contemplated by the Transaction Documents (unless such action is solely based upon a material breach of such Purchaser Party’s representations, warranties or covenants under the Transaction Documents or any agreements or understandings such Purchaser Party may have with any such stockholder or any violations by such Purchaser Party of state or federal securities laws or any conduct by such Purchaser Party which is finally judicially determined to constitute fraud, gross negligence or willful misconduct). If any action shall be brought against any Purchaser Party in respect of which indemnity may be sought pursuant to this Agreement, such Purchaser Party shall promptly notify the Company in writing, and the Company shall have the right to assume the defense thereof with counsel of its own choosing reasonably acceptable to the Purchaser Party. Any Purchaser Party shall have the right to employ separate counsel in any such action and participate in the defense thereof, but the fees and expenses of such counsel shall be at the expense of such Purchaser Party except to the extent that (i) the employment thereof has been specifically authorized by the Company in writing, (ii) the Company has failed after a reasonable period of time to assume such defense and to employ counsel or (iii) in such action there is, in the reasonable opinion of counsel, a material conflict on any material issue between the position of the Company and the position of such Purchaser Party, in which case the Company shall be responsible for the reasonable fees and expenses of no more than one such separate counsel. The Company will not be liable to any Purchaser Party under this Agreement (y) for any settlement by a Purchaser Party effected without the Company’s prior written consent, which shall not be unreasonably withheld or delayed; or (z) to the extent, but only to the extent that a loss, claim, damage or liability is attributable to any Purchaser Party’s breach of any of the representations, warranties, covenants or agreements made by such Purchaser Party in this Agreement or in the other Transaction Documents. The indemnification required by this Section 4.8 shall be made by periodic payments of the amount thereof during the course of the investigation or defense, as and when bills are received or are incurred. The indemnity agreements contained herein shall be in addition to any cause of action or similar right of any Purchaser Party against the Company or others and any liabilities the Company may be subject to pursuant to law.

  • Company's Indemnification In the event of any registration under the Act of any Warrant Shares pursuant to this Article 3, the Company hereby agrees to indemnify and hold harmless each Warrantholder disposing of such Warrant Shares and each other person, if any, who controls such Warrantholder within the meaning of Section 15 of the Act and each other person (including underwriters) who participates in the offering of such Warrant Shares against any losses, claims, damages or liabilities, joint or several, to which such Warrantholder or controlling person or participating person may become subject under the Act or otherwise, in so far as such losses, claims, damages or liabilities (or proceedings in respect thereof) arise out of or are based upon any untrue statement or alleged untrue statement of any material fact contained, on the effective date thereof, in any registration statement under which such Warrant Shares were registered under the Act, in any preliminary prospectus or final prospectus contained therein, or in any amendment or supplement thereto, or arise out of or are based upon the omission or alleged omission to state therein a material fact required to be stated therein or necessary to make the statements therein not misleading, and will reimburse such Warrantholder and each such controlling person or participating person for any legal or any other expenses incurred by such Warrantholder or such controlling person or participating person in connection with investigating or defending any such loss, claim, damage, liability or proceeding; PROVIDED, HOWEVER, that the Company will not be liable in any such case to the extent that any such loss, claim, damage or liability arises out of or is based upon: (a) an untrue statement or alleged untrue statement or omission or alleged omission made in such registration statement, said preliminary or final prospectus or said amendment or supplement in reliance upon and in conformity with written information furnished to the Company by such Warrantholder or such controlling or participating person, as the case may be, specifically for use in the preparation thereof; or (b) an untrue statement or alleged untrue statement, omission or alleged omission in a prospectus if such untrue statement or alleged untrue statement, omission or alleged omission is corrected in an amendment or supplement to the prospectus which amendment or supplement is delivered to such Warrantholder and such Warrantholder thereafter fails to deliver such prospectus as so amended or supplemented prior to or concurrently with the sale of Warrant Shares to the person asserting such loss, claim, damage, liability or expense.

  • Indemnification of the Initial Purchasers The Company agrees to indemnify and hold harmless each Initial Purchaser, its affiliates, directors, officers and employees, and each person, if any, who controls any Initial Purchaser within the meaning of the Securities Act and the Exchange Act against any loss, claim, damage, liability or expense, as incurred, to which such Initial Purchaser, affiliate, director, officer, employee or controlling person may become subject, under the Securities Act, the Exchange Act or other federal or state statutory law or regulation, or at common law or otherwise (including in settlement of any litigation, if such settlement is effected with the written consent of the Company), insofar as such loss, claim, damage, liability or expense (or actions in respect thereof as contemplated below) arises out of or is based upon any untrue statement or alleged untrue statement of a material fact contained in the Preliminary Offering Memorandum, the Final Term Sheet, any Company Additional Written Communication or the Final Offering Memorandum (or any amendment or supplement thereto), or the omission or alleged omission therefrom of a material fact necessary in order to make the statements therein, in the light of the circumstances under which they were made, not misleading; and to reimburse each Initial Purchaser and each such affiliate, director, officer, employee or controlling person for any and all expenses (including the fees and disbursements of counsel chosen by the Representatives) as such expenses are reasonably incurred by such Initial Purchaser or such affiliate, director, officer, employee or controlling person in connection with investigating, defending, settling, compromising or paying any such loss, claim, damage, liability, expense or action; provided, however, that the foregoing indemnity agreement shall not apply, with respect to an Initial Purchaser, to any loss, claim, damage, liability or expense to the extent, but only to the extent, arising out of or based upon any untrue statement or alleged untrue statement or omission or alleged omission made in reliance upon and in conformity with written information furnished to the Company by such Initial Purchaser through the Representatives expressly for use in the Preliminary Offering Memorandum, the Final Term Sheet, any Company Additional Written Communication or the Final Offering Memorandum (or any amendment or supplement thereto). The indemnity agreement set forth in this Section 8(a) shall be in addition to any liabilities that the Company may otherwise have.
